Wikipedia

  1. defiled

    The Defiled were a four-piece British band from London mixing groove-laden hardcore/metal with industrial music influences. They have been described by Kerrang! magazine as "The saviours of UK Metal" and championed by Metal Hammer as one of the leaders in a new wave of British metal along with bands such as While She Sleeps, Bury Tomorrow and Devil Sold His Soul. The band have built a fanbase following support slots with bands such as Murderdolls, Static-X, Godsmack, Deathstars and Motionless in White as well as playing Bloodstock, Download and Sonisphere festivals.

ChatGPT

  1. defiled

    Defiled refers to the act of polluting, contaminating, or making something unclean or impure, often in a moral, spiritual or ceremonial sense. It can also mean to tarnish, violate or desecrate something considered sacred or respected.
